Investing for Citizenship

In recent years, the concept of obtaining citizenship through investment has gained popularity as an attractive option for individuals looking to expand their global mobility and secure a second passport. Known as Citizenship by Investment (CBI) programs, these initiatives allow eligible individuals to acquire citizenship in a foreign country by making a significant financial investment in that nation’s economy.
Benefits of Citizenship by Investment: 1. Global Mobility: Owning a second passport obtained through a CBI program can grant individuals the freedom to travel visa-free or with easier visa requirements to multiple countries around the world. This increased mobility is highly appealing for business professionals, frequent travelers, and individuals seeking enhanced opportunities for work, education, or leisure.
2. Business Opportunities: Citizenship by Investment can open doors to new business opportunities in the host country and beyond. By becoming a citizen, investors gain access to new markets, favorable tax regimes, and a secure environment for business growth and expansion.
3. Personal Security: Diversifying citizenship can provide a sense of security for individuals and their families in times of political instability, economic uncertainty, or social unrest in their home country. With an alternative citizenship, investors have the peace of mind knowing they have a safe haven to seek refuge if needed.
4. Education and Healthcare: Access to quality education and healthcare services are essential considerations for families planning for their future. Citizenship by Investment programs can offer individuals the opportunity to access top-tier educational institutions and healthcare facilities in the host country, providing a better quality of life for themselves and their loved ones.
Key Considerations for Investors: 1. Investment Options: CBI programs typically require investors to make a financial contribution to a designated government fund, purchase real estate, or invest in a government-approved project in exchange for citizenship. It is essential to carefully evaluate the investment options available under each program to determine the best fit for your financial goals and personal preferences.
2. Due Diligence: Before committing to a Citizenship by Investment program, investors should conduct thorough due diligence on the host country, program requirements, application process, and potential benefits. Consulting with legal and financial advisors experienced in CBI programs can help navigate the complexities and ensure a smooth application process.
3. Long-Term Planning: Obtaining citizenship through investment is a long-term commitment that requires careful planning and consideration of the implications on your personal and financial circumstances. Investors should assess the potential impact on their tax obligations, estate planning, and overall wealth management strategy before proceeding with a CBI program.
